Welcome Brett Jackson
Please welcome Brett Jackson, to our Hey Team! Brett is a Landscape Architect with 10 years+ experience. He is a graduate of Indiana University with a B.S. in Biology (natural systems-ecology) and received his Master of Landscape Architecture degree from Ball State University.
Brett’s design experience includes urban design, Complete Streets streetscapes, municipal design, parks and open spaces, community and master planning, academic and medical campus design, single-multifamily housing, historic preservation, green infrastructure- bioswales, rain gardens, green roofs, living walls, and vernacular design and ecologies: Rocky Mountain, Ohio River Valley, Greater Appalachia, and Great Lakes bioregions.
His graphic design skills include illustrative plans and cross-sections, 3D modeling, renderings, animations, drone-integrated flyovers, (project) video editing, and website design.
Brett’s implementation experience includes Resident Engineering services, site observation and construction documentation-reporting, material sampling and quantification, soil sampling and analysis, tree and pond surveying, specification writing, construction submittals and RFIs.
Some of his personal interests include conservation and biodiversity, nature-based solutions, biophilic design and biomimicry, fluvial-geomorphological design, plant knowledge-planting design, and Soil Life.
